How Does the Design and Prototyping Phase Work?
The design and prototyping phase begins when clients submit their creative vision, which can range from professional digital artwork to simple hand-drawn sketches on paper. Manufacturers work with virtually any format, transforming rough concepts into tangible prototypes that capture the essence of the original idea. This flexibility allows businesses without in-house design teams to participate fully in custom plush toy design.
What Materials Do Clients Need to Provide?
Clients typically supply reference images, colour specifications, and dimensional requirements for their desired stuffed animal. A basic sketch showing front and side views proves sufficient for most projects, though detailed illustrations help manufacturers understand intricate features. Pantone colour codes ensure accurate colour matching, whilst written descriptions clarify textures, material preferences, and any special features like removable accessories or sound modules.
How Do Manufacturers Transform Concepts into Physical Prototypes?
Professional pattern makers translate two-dimensional artwork into three-dimensional specifications, creating technical patterns that account for seam allowances, stuffing distribution, and structural integrity. The stuffed animal prototyping process involves selecting appropriate fabrics, determining optimal stuffing density, and constructing a sample that matches the client’s vision. Skilled seamstresses handcraft initial prototypes, paying careful attention to proportions, facial expressions, and overall character.
What Happens During the Prototype Approval Process?
Manufacturers ship the first prototype to clients for hands-on evaluation, allowing them to assess size, colour accuracy, material quality, and overall appearance. This tangible sample reveals details that drawings cannot convey, such as how the plush toy feels, how it sits or stands, and whether facial features convey the intended expression. Clients photograph the prototype from multiple angles and share detailed feedback about any modifications needed.
The prototype approval process includes unlimited revisions, ensuring the final design meets exact specifications before production begins. Common adjustments include:
- Colour refinements to match brand guidelines precisely
- Proportion adjustments to improve visual balance
- Feature modifications such as eye placement or limb positioning
- Material substitutions for improved texture or durability
- Size alterations to meet packaging or display requirements

What Quality and Safety Standards Must Be Met?
Stuffed animal safety standards are the foundation of any legitimate custom plush manufacturing operation. Products destined for retail must comply with regulations such as ASTM F963 in the United States, EN71 in Europe, and similar standards in other markets. These regulations cover everything from flammability and mechanical hazards to chemical composition, ensuring that plush toys pose no risk to children or consumers.
Plush Toy Compliance Testing
Plush toy compliance testing occurs at certified third-party laboratories before products reach retail shelves. Manufacturers submit samples for rigorous evaluation that includes:
- Pull tests to verify seams and attachments withstand appropriate force
- Small parts testing to prevent choking hazards
- Flammability assessments to meet fire safety requirements
- Chemical analysis to detect prohibited substances like lead or phthalates
- Age-grading verification to ensure appropriate labelling
The testing process typically takes 2-4 weeks and generates documentation that retailers require before accepting inventory. Reputable manufacturers maintain relationships with accredited testing facilities and factor these timelines into production schedules.
Material Selection for Safety and Durability
High-quality plush manufacturing begins with carefully vetted materials that balance safety, durability, and aesthetic appeal. Manufacturers source fabrics, stuffing, and components from suppliers who provide material safety data sheets and compliance certificates. Polyester fibres dominate the industry due to their hypoallergenic properties, washability, and resistance to deterioration.
Eyes, noses, and decorative elements require particular attention. Embroidered features eliminate choking risks associated with plastic components, making them ideal for products targeting young children. When plastic elements are necessary, manufacturers use safety eyes with secure locking washers that withstand pull forces exceeding regulatory requirements.
Thread quality directly impacts product longevity. Industrial-grade polyester thread prevents seam failure even after repeated washing and handling. Manufacturers specify double-stitching or reinforced seams at stress points such as limbs and attachment areas.

How Are Pricing and Order Quantities Determined?
Custom stuffed animal pricing depends on complexity, materials, size, and order volume, with most manufacturers requiring a minimum order quantity of 500 pieces. This threshold allows factories to set up production lines efficiently whilst keeping per-unit costs reasonable for clients entering the retail market.
Understanding Minimum Order Requirements
The 500-piece minimum serves as an industry standard because it balances manufacturing efficiency with client accessibility. Smaller quantities drive up per-unit costs significantly due to setup fees, tooling expenses, and labour allocation. Manufacturers invest in creating custom moulds, cutting patterns, and quality control systems specific to each design—costs that spread more favourably across larger production runs.
Some factories offer tiered minimums based on product complexity:
- Simple designs: 500 pieces minimum
- Moderate complexity: 750-1,000 pieces
- Highly detailed characters: 1,500+ pieces
How Volume Affects Custom Stuffed Animal Pricing
Bulk order price breaks create substantial savings as quantities increase. A 500-piece order might cost £8 per unit, whilst a 2,000-piece order could drop to £5.50 per unit—a 31% reduction. These economies of scale emerge from reduced setup time per unit, better material purchasing power, and streamlined production workflows.
Price break tiers typically follow this structure:
- 500-999 pieces: Base pricing
- 1,000-2,499 pieces: 15-20% discount
- 2,500-4,999 pieces: 25-30% discount
- 5,000+ pieces: 35-40% discount
Manufacturers negotiate these rates based on design specifications, material choices, and production timelines. Rush orders command premium pricing, whilst flexible delivery schedules may unlock additional discounts.

How Is Bulk Production Managed After Prototype Approval?
Mass production stuffed animals begins immediately once clients approve the final prototype. Manufacturers transition from single-unit creation to full-scale production by preparing detailed specifications, material orders, and production schedules that replicate the approved sample across hundreds or thousands of units.
Setting Up the Production Line
The plush toy manufacturing process requires manufacturers to create comprehensive production blueprints that document every detail of the approved prototype. These blueprints specify fabric types, stitching patterns, stuffing density, embroidery placements, and assembly sequences. Production teams use these documents to set up specialised equipment and train workers on the specific requirements of each custom design.
Material procurement happens in parallel with production setup. Manufacturers order fabrics, threads, stuffing materials, and accessories in quantities sufficient for the entire order plus a safety margin. Bulk material orders often arrive from multiple suppliers, requiring careful inventory management to ensure all components meet the quality standards established during prototyping.
Quality Control Checkpoints
Consistency across large production runs demands rigorous quality control measures at multiple stages. Manufacturers implement inspection points throughout the assembly process rather than waiting until completion:
- Pre-production inspection: Verifying all materials match prototype specifications
- In-line inspection: Checking products at key assembly stages (cutting, sewing, stuffing, finishing)
- Final inspection: Examining completed units before packaging
- Random sampling: Testing a percentage of finished products against the approved prototype
Quality control teams use the approved prototype as the gold standard, comparing each batch against this reference sample. Any deviations trigger immediate corrections to prevent defects from propagating through the entire production run.
Production Timeline Management
Effective production timeline management balances speed with quality to meet agreed delivery dates. Manufacturers break down the total order quantity into manageable production batches, allowing for continuous quality monitoring without overwhelming the production line. A typical 5,000-unit order might be divided into ten batches of 500 units each, with quality checks between batches.
Production schedules account for various factors:
- Complexity of design: Intricate details or multiple components require more time per unit
- Material availability: Delays in receiving specialised fabrics or accessories
- Seasonal demand: Peak periods may require extended production hours
What Logistics Are Involved in Delivering Finished Products?
Delivering custom stuffed animals requires strategic planning across packaging, transportation, and timing to ensure products arrive in pristine condition. Manufacturers coordinate multiple logistics elements simultaneously, from selecting appropriate packaging materials that showcase retail appeal to arranging freight solutions capable of handling bulk orders whilst maintaining strict delivery schedules.
How Should Custom Plush Toys Be Packaged for Retail?
Packaging serves dual purposes: protecting products during transit and presenting them attractively for retail display. Custom stuffed animals typically receive individual polybags or protective wrapping before being placed in master cartons, with each layer designed to prevent crushing, moisture damage, or contamination during the journey from factory to retail floor.
Retail-ready packaging often includes:
- Individual protective sleeves with hang tags and branding elements already attached
- Display-ready boxes that retailers can place directly on shelves without repackaging
- Custom outer cartons featuring handling instructions and product identification
- Moisture-resistant materials to protect plush fabrics from humidity exposure
The packaging strategy depends on the client’s specific retail requirements. Amusement park merchandise may need eye-catching display boxes, whilst promotional giveaways might require minimal packaging to reduce costs. Manufacturers work closely with clients to determine the optimal packaging solution that balances protection, presentation, and budget constraints.
What Shipping Methods Work Best for Large Plush Toy Orders?
Coordinating stuffed animal shipping logistics for orders of 500 pieces or more demands careful selection of freight methods based on destination, timeline, and cost parameters. Sea freight remains the most economical option for international shipments, though it requires advance planning with transit times ranging from 4-8 weeks depending on routing.
Air freight becomes necessary when clients face tight deadlines for retail launches or seasonal promotions. Whilst significantly more expensive than ocean transport, air shipping reduces transit time to 5-10 days, making it viable for time-sensitive campaigns. Manufacturers maintain relationships with multiple freight forwarders to secure competitive rates and reliable service.
Domestic shipments within the same country typically utilise:
- Full truckload (FTL) services for orders exceeding 10,000 units
- Less-than-truckload (LTL) options for smaller shipments consolidating with other cargo
By carefully managing these logistics aspects—packaging design tailored to retail preferences and strategic selection of shipping methods—manufacturers can ensure that their custom plush toys reach stores in perfect condition and on schedule.
